Summary

Repealing a certain restriction on an establishment for which a stadium beer, wine, and liquor license may be issued in Harford County; repealing a certain restriction on a stadium beer, wine, and liquor license in Harford County that allows an individual to serve liquor during a baseball game only in certain areas of the stadium; and repealing a certain restriction prohibiting a license holder from allowing a roving vendor to dispense beer in the stadium.
